Citation abstract
Four new spiroaxane sesquiterpenes, tramspiroins A-D (1-4), one new rosenonolactone 15,16-acetonide (5), and the known drimane sesquiterpenes isodrimenediol (6) and funatrol D (7) have been isolated from the cultures of Basidiomycete Trametes versicolor. The structures of new compounds were elucidated by means of spectroscopic methods. Compounds 1-7 were investigated for their cytotoxicities against five human cancer cell lines.
